Manneville-la-Pipard is a French municipality with 290 inhabitants (as of January 1 2017) of the department of Calvados in the region of Normandy . Administratively it is assigned to the canton of Pont-l'Évêque and the Arrondissement of Lisieux . The inhabitants are called Mannevillais .
geography
Manneville-la-Pipard is located about 35 kilometers south-southeast of Le Havre in the Pays d'Auge landscape on the Calonne , which borders the municipality to the west. Manneville-la-Pipard is surrounded by the neighboring communities of Saint-Julien-sur-Calonne in the north, Les Authieux-sur-Calonne in the northeast, Le Mesnil-sur-Blangy in the east, Fierville-les-Parcs in the south, Pierrefitte-en- Auge in the west and Pont-l'Évêque in the west.
Population development
| year | 1962 | 1968 | 1975 | 1982 | 1990 | 1999 | 2006 | 2013 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Residents | 242 | 236 | 213 | 290 | 317 | 348 | 316 | 309 |
| Source: Cassini and INSEE | ||||||||
